Duties/Responsibilities:
- Collect, label, appropriately prepare and store lab samples according to laboratory specifications.
- Prepare lab requisitions in computer by acquiring all information required.
- Ensure collection lab specimens by appropriate lab courier.
- Take initiative and action to respond, resolve and follow up regarding patients in a timely manner.
- Comply with Synergy policies, protocols and procedures (Employee Handbook, QA manual, Compliance)
Requirements:
- Excellent phlebotomy skills
- Good time management skills and ability to work with minimal on site supervision.
- Ability to work in fast paced environment
- Commitment to provide quality work with no errors
- Demonstrate excellent customer service and patient care.
- Work well with others and ability to problem solve.
- Have experience processing clinical samples.
Physical Demands:
The physical demands and work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Day to day work includes desk and personal computer entry and interaction with patients, facility staff and physicians. Candidate must be able to sit, stand, bend, walk, kneel and carry up 25lbs.
